  • Reminder: The First Ever Card Buffs Arrive This Week! Prepare for Mechs!

    Let's hope it has an impact. I fear most people will stick to what they've been already doing and not change much, since most of these cards do not slot into their usual decks but require their own build. I'll definitely try to give Senor Pogo another shot, since the potential combo with Magic Carpet covers its main weakness and Witchwood Piper can now reliably tutor the rabbit out. Considering how slammed my Jade Shudderwock Shaman got yesterday when I queued up against a Pogo Rogue with god draw, it's obvious the deck has some potential if the stars align. Maybe the alignment will be just a little bit easier now. Also would be nice for the Necromechanic to see play, since that would mean the brainless aggro Mech Hunter might be a little more rare in Wild.

    Really cool idea, I did something similar last season. Got to rank 4 around half of the month and decided to try reaching legend for the first time. Instead of grinding for hours (and surely losing my temper and my concentration), I set myself the goal to win 2 more games than I lost every day for the rest of the month. So some days, I played only two games, later I had to play for two hours to make that progress of plus 2 wins from where I started that day. But in the end, it worked out: I reached legend and did so without tilting once and in a way shorter time than I expected.

    So having made that experience and considering yours, that seems a really great way to play :) Because, in the end it's still a game and I dont want to walk away from it angry.
